grub/dual-boot problem



I'm having a grub/dual-boot problem.

I'm running Sarge with the kernel from the initial
install. The hard drive has 4 primary partitions:

part 1 = win xp
part 2 = /boot --> marked bootable in partition table
part 3 = /
part 4 = swap

I installed win XP into part 1. I then installed Sarge
and updated grub. On reboot, everything was fine --
grub showed a menu with both win xp and linux. I could
boot into linux fine. I had to then boot into windows.
Now, on reboot, the grub menu doesn't come up; the
machine goes straight into windows.

Is there anything I can do in my grub setup to prevent
this? It would be nice to actually be able to go back
and forth.
